At the present time, I'm working on the development of novel electrode materials based on thin films of conductive polymers as polypyrrole (PPy) and polyaniline (PAni) that I then modify by inserting metal particles (Pd, Au, Pt...). The final material is a composite film with homogeneous microstructure and high electrochemical properties. I would like to use these materials for fuel cell applications. So, at the laboratory scale, what kind of techniques should I start with?
